Snow Days: Jammu Summer Zone Schools Get Extra Time Off

Winter has woven its icy enchantment around the schools in the summer zone of Jammu, and the Directorate of School Education Jammu (DSEJ) has taken notice of the frosty weather conditions. With the recent extension of the winter vacation for an additional two days, both students and teachers can revel in a little extra time snuggled up indoors.

In an official decree released by Director School Education Jammu, Ashok Kumar Sharma, the winter vacation has been prolonged until January 6, 2024, for government and privately recognised schools in the summer zone of Jammu division. This decision has been made in response to the harsh weather, ensuring the safety and well-being of all those involved in the realm of education.

The order, known as No 1354-DSEJ of 2023 dated December 18, 2023, has firmly cautioned against any breaches of the extended vacation period. It has been unequivocally stated that any flouting of the schedule by school administrators or teaching staff will result in consequential actions under Rules. This resolute stance underscores the importance placed on adhering to the extended winter vacation.

Reflecting on the initial announcement of a ten-day winter vacation made on December 18, 2023, granting a much-needed break from December 26, 2023, to January 4, 2024. Now, with the additional two days, students and educators have a bit more time to relax and rejuvenate before returning to the school routine.

In support of continued learning, the DSEJ has also urged teachers to remain available for online guidance of students during the vacation period.
